#6c98c6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c98c6 is composed of 42.4% red, 59.6%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.5% cyan, 23.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 210.7 degrees, a saturation of 44.1% and a lightness of 60%. #6c98c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ffff with #00318d.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#6c98c6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c98c6 has RGB values of R:108, G:152, B:198 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 7116998.

Shades and Tints of #6c98c6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030608 is the darkest color, while #f9fbfd is the lightest one.
